My previous post reviewing Andrew Etter's ebook on Modern Technical Writing got an enormous response. Some readers said the docs-as-code approach works only for small shops and doesn't scale to large projects. They said content re-use and translation also become problematic. However, perhaps the real differentiator shouldn't be product size as much as product category. The docs-as-code approach (which is what I'm calling it) works particularly well for developer documentation, such as API documentation, which usually doesn't contain the same challenges that component content management systems (or CCMSs) were meant to solve.

Functional animation is subtle animation that has a clear, logical purpose. It reduces cognitive load, prevents change blindness and establishes a better recall in spatial relationships. But there is one more thing. Animation brings user interface to life.
Motion can make surfaces feel alive by multiplying and dividing them, and changing their shape and size. You should use functional animation to smoothly transport users between navigational contexts, explain changes in the arrangement of elements on a screen, and reinforce element hierarchy.

Once you decide that managing content across the enterprise is a smart move, you'll soon grapple with a number of the thorny issues as you determine a strategy for moving to a structured content solution like a DITA CCMS. One of the biggest is what to do with your existing content. Unfortunately you can't simply push a button and magically migrate everything.
